What happens for you when you go to the site? When i go to countryexposure.com (assuming that's the domain you are inquiring about) I get a forbidden message. Now a lot of people install WordPress to a WordPress directory. Which it appears is the case for countryexposure.com, for when you go to countryexposure.com/wordpress I get a message saying : "There doesn't seem to be a wp-config.php file. I need this before we can get started. Need more help? We got it. You can create a wp-config.php file through a web interface, but this doesn't work for all server setups. The safest way is to manually create the file." This indicated that there is not a database issue, but just the fact that you have no wp-config.php file to connect to the database with. I believe once you create and set up this file your issue will be resolved.
